If this is about the Hopper, it's pretty sad since the vast majority of Dish customers don't even have a Hopper (it's pretty new). And yes, the Hopper does a great job of skipping commercials (prime time network stations only), but I could live without the feature. It also has the skip 30 seconds button which makes skipping commercials almost as easy (as do other DVRs).
